# Using extensions
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Extensions are a more convenient form of user scripts.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Extensions all exist in their own subdirectory inside the `extensions` directory. You can use git to install an extension like this:
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
```
|
||||||
|
git clone https://github.com/AUTOMATIC1111/stable-diffusion-webui-aesthetic-gradients extensions/aesthetic-gradients
|
||||||
|
```
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
This installs an extension from `https://github.com/AUTOMATIC1111/stable-diffusion-webui-aesthetic-gradients` into the `extensions/aesthetic-gradients` directory.

# Developing extensions
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Web ui interacts with installed extensions in the following way:
|
||||||
|
- extension's scripts in the `scripts` directory are executed as if they were just usual user scripts, except:
|
||||||
|
- `sys.path` is extended to include the extension directory, so you can import anything in it without worrying
|
||||||
|
- you can use `scripts.basedir()` to get the current extension's directory (since user can name it anything he wants)
|
||||||
|
- extension's javascript files in the `javascript` directory are added to the page
|
||||||
|
- extension's `style.css` file is added to the page
